diff histogram: intern strings
Histogram is the only diff algorithm not to call xdl_classify_record(). xdl_classify_record() ensures that the hash values of two strings that are not equal differ which means that it is not necessary to use xdl_recmatch() when comparing lines, all that is necessary is to compare the hash values. This gives a 7% reduction in the runtime of "git log --patch" when using the histogram diff algorithm.
